Title: A Zymography technique to study amino acid activation by aminoacyl tRNA synthetases (aaRS): A broad spectrum, high-throughput tool to screen activities of aaRS and their “Urzyme” variants

Abstract: Amino acyl tRNA synthetases or aaRSs play a key role in assuring the precision of protein 13 translation. They are highly specific for their cognate amino acid and cognate tRNA 14 substrates during protein synthesis, utilizing ATP to ensure that proper assignments are made 15 between amino acid and anticodon. Specific aaRS for each amino acid are present in all cells. 16 We describe a new zymography technique to qualitatively visualize and semi-quantitatively 17 determine the amino acid activation capacity of each type of aaRS molecule by indirect 18 colorimetric detection of released pyrophosphates during the formation of aminoacyl-AMP. 19 Protein samples containing aaRS are subjected to Native PAGE, followed by incubation in 20 buffer containing cognate amino acid and ATP for sufficient time to generate pyrophosphates 21 (PPi) which are then converted to inorganic phosphates by pyrophosphatase treatment.
